A women's tennis team from a local health club beat out some tough Central Valley competition. In-Shape Sports Club’s women’s tennis team finished its seven-month season in first place in the Central Valley Tennis League. The Tracy A Red team, with its win April 22 against the West Lane A team from the Stockton In-Shape club, finished its season with a 21-1 record, just ahead of the Oak Park A team, 20-2, the only team to beat the Tracy players, and that was during a game way back in March.“We were undefeated in the first half of the season, and we felt pretty good about that,” Tracy team captain Patty Cole said, adding that it’s the first time the local team has taken first place. “It’s tough competition. It’s a good league.” Three of Tracy’s players finished among the top 15 in the league in winning percentage in the 12-team A league. Lori Wehrli was undefeated in 15 matches, Patti Guzman was 20-1 and Serena Reinin was 19-1. Cole said that all competition is in doubles play, and each league meeting includes five doubles matches. In last week’s matchup against West Lane at In-Shape on Tracy Boulevard, Tracy’s Desiree Bozek and Kendall George lost, 6-0, to West Lane’s Marianne Boyce and Therese McCarthy; Tracy’s Guzman and Reinin beat Gayle Miyasaki and Janice Yamada, 6-1, 6-0; Tracy’s Mischelle Fleisch and Wehrli beat Tonya Duval and Lisa Hanson, 6-0, 6-4; Tracy’s Carolyn Genest and Mary Ann Brenkwitz beat Grace Atwater and Connie Rishwain, 6-3, 6-0; and Cole and Kay C. Denholm beat Julie Rule and Becky Ivary, 6-2, 6-0.
